Bunk beds come in several styles to match diverse preferences and needs. Here are some popular alternatives:
Standard Bunk Bed: This traditional design features two beds stacked vertically, normally with a ladder entrance.
Loft Bed: This style has just the leading bunk, permitting open space below, which can be used for a desk, seating, or storage.
L-Shaped bunk beds cheap Bed: Arranged at ideal angles, this style offers an unique design and provides additional space for extra furniture.
Twin Over Full: This style features a twin mattress on leading and a full-sized bed mattress on the bottom, accommodating more sleeping space.
Triple Bunk Bed: Great for bigger families, this design features three stacked beds however may need greater ceilings.

How high should the ceiling be for a bunk bed?
A ceiling height of a minimum of 8 feet is normally advised for a standard bunk bed. It permits enough space between the top bunk and the ceiling for security and comfort.
Can adults sleep on bunk beds?
Yes, numerous bunk beds are developed to accommodate adults, however it is vital to examine the weight capability and stability of the bed.
Are there any special mattress requirements for bunk beds?
Many bunk beds support basic bed mattress sizes, however it's important to validate the thickness and measurements for the best fit and security.
How can I guarantee the durability of a bunk bed?
Regular maintenance, such as looking for loose screws, making sure mattress supports are in location, and keeping the bunk bed tidy, will assist lengthen its life expectancy.
